Why do my 1970s copper pipes keep springing leaks?

Copper pipes from the 1970s often develop pinhole leaks due to a combination of age and water chemistry. Over decades, minerals in the water create microscopic corrosion points that eventually penetrate the pipe wall. Joint calcification is another issue—mineral deposits build up at solder joints, creating stress points that crack. These failures typically start appearing around the 40-50 year mark, which is where Guttenberg's plumbing infrastructure currently stands.

Does Jersey City Reservoir water damage my plumbing fixtures?

Water from Jersey City Reservoir has high mineral content, creating hard water conditions. This leads to scale buildup inside water heaters, reducing efficiency by up to 30% over time. Fixtures like showerheads and faucet aerators clog with mineral deposits, decreasing water pressure. The scale also accelerates corrosion in older copper pipes, particularly in water heaters where temperatures concentrate the minerals.

What should I do to prevent frozen pipes during Guttenberg winters?

Even with our temperate climate, winter temperatures can drop to 26°F during freezes. Insulate pipes in unheated areas like crawl spaces and garages. Keep cabinet doors open to allow warm air to circulate around plumbing during cold snaps. Let faucets drip slightly during extreme cold to maintain water movement. These simple measures prevent the most common freeze-related emergencies I see in Guttenberg each winter.

As an urban condo owner, what plumbing issues should I watch for?

Municipal water pressure in urban settings like Guttenberg typically runs higher than in suburban areas, putting additional stress on older copper pipes. Shared building infrastructure means one unit's leak can affect neighbors. Condo associations often have specific requirements for plumbing repairs that must align with building codes. Regular pressure checks and prompt leak repairs prevent most urban plumbing emergencies.
